Health issues
The brachycephalic features of Frenchies that make them so adorable can also trigger health issues. Their nasals that are shorter can cause breathing problems because they compress the tissues in the throat's back. They also have a higher risk of spinal deformities because of their shortened bones. These conditions can cause discomfort and pain but they are generally treated with ease.

Another health issue is a genetic heart disease known as dilated cardiomyopathy, which causes enlarged hearts that can't effectively pump blood. The increase in size could also trigger irregular heart rhythms. It's important to choose a responsible breeder and keep your French Bulldog up-to-date on yearly vaccinations and parasite preventatives.
Frenchies are susceptible to digestive issues such as food allergies and an inflammatory intestinal condition which can cause chronic diarrhea. They are also susceptible to pyometra, an infection of the uterus and mammary tumors. Due to their diminutive faces, Frenchies have narrow nostrils and are more likely to suffer from respiratory disorders such as brachycephalic obstruction of airways (BOAS). This condition is caused due to the compression of tissues in their nasal passages, which are shortened. This can result in wheezing, a cough and difficulty breathing.
They are also more vulnerable to heat stroke since they do not pant efficiently and are less able to regulate their body temperature. To help them avoid this, you should never leave them in hot weather or keep them in a crate them for prolonged durations of time. You should also monitor their exercise needs during the summer. Training
Frenchies are intelligent and Französische bulldogge welpen kaufen adaptable dogs who are loyal companions for their owners. They are sociable dogs that thrive in interaction. They also require moderate exercise. Because of their calm demeanors and versatility, they are great pets for single people, couples, or families. If you live in an apartment or a house with an outdoor space They are a low-maintenance dog who require only occasional walks and playtime.
Like other breeds of dog, French Bulldogs are very adept to clicker training and other methods of positive reinforcement. This makes them a good choice for beginners who are looking to train their dog with rewards-based methods. If you're new to training, you can purchase a book or an e-course with step-by-step instructions for teaching your Frenchie basic commands.
If your French Bulldog starts chewing on things that he shouldn't, try distracting him and then returning him to the thing he should be chewing on. If he's chewing on items that can damage, such as shoes or furniture, redirect him to a tough rubber toy. Encourage him to start chewing on a suitable object. Do not make harsh verbal corrections or punishments, when chewing on a prohibited object.
